Michael Lindqvist (born 12 December 1994) is a Swedish professional ice hockey forward for Leksands IF of the Swedish Hockey League (SHL).
Playing career
Lindqvist made his Elitserien debut playing with AIK during the 2012–13 Elitserien season.[1]
Having played seven seasons within the AIK organization and with the club continuing in the Allsvenskan, Lindqvist left the club and signed a contract to return to the SHL with Färjestad BK on 31 March 2017.[2] In the following 2017–18 season, Lindqvist led the club in points per game and established new career highs with 20 goals and 34 points in just 33 games.
On 2 May 2018, as an undrafted free agent, Lindqvist agreed to terms on a one-year contract with the New York Rangers of the National Hockey League (NHL).[3] On 13 November, the Rangers placed Lindqvist on waivers with the intention of buying out his contract.[4] On 14 November, he returned to Sweden and signed a contract until the end of the 2018–19 season with his former team, Färjestad BK of the SHL.[5]
On 2 June 2025, Lindqvist joined his third SHL outfit, signing a two-year contract as a free agent with Leksands IF.[6]
